oko
noun
Meaning
- fruit
Etymology / origin
Related to Tocharian A oko (“id”), but through what manner is uncertain. Probably borrowed from Tocharian B to Tocharian A, in which case ultimately from Proto-Indo-European *h₂ógeh₂ (“berry, fruit”).
